  1. Howard Elliott Ashman (May 17, 1950 – March 14, 1991) was an American playwright, lyricist and stage director. He is most widely known for his work on feature films for Walt Disney Animation Studios , for which Ashman wrote the lyrics and Alan Menken composed the music. [2]

  4. A Native of Baltimore, Howard was Born in 1950. He found his passion early on, joining Baltimore's Children's Theater Association while in grade school, and never wavering from his first love. in 1974, after graduating from Goddard College in Vermont and receiving his MFA from Indiana University, Ashman moved to New York.
